Overview

Yooz is a cloud-based purchase-to-pay and accounts payable automation platform built for small and mid-sized finance teams. It uses proprietary AI and RPA to automate invoice capture, GL coding, approval workflows, payments, vendor statement reconciliation, and fraud detection, with an emphasis on speed, ease of use, and fast deployment. Yooz markets very high levels of touchless processing and substantial reductions in invoice processing time and cost.

The platform spans the procure-to-pay cycle, including purchase requisitions and orders through to payment and reconciliation, and added a direct payment feature in its "Yooz Rising" product line. It integrates with a large number of accounting and ERP systems, positioning itself as a flexible add-on for organizations that want strong AP automation without enterprise complexity.

Yooz was founded in 2010 with roots in document-processing expertise, and is headquartered in Aimargues, France, with a significant US presence. It is a privately held company serving customers across dozens of countries.

Yooz prices per document, starting around $1.99 for lower volumes and scaling down toward $1.00 at high volume. That makes it one of the easiest AP tools to model honestly: multiply your monthly invoice count by the applicable rate. It also means the comparison against per-seat products like BILL flips depending on your ratio of invoices to approvers — high invoice volume with few approvers favours per-seat pricing, and the reverse favours Yooz. Yooz — frequently asked questions

Who is Yooz designed for?

Small and mid-sized finance teams that want strong AP and purchase-to-pay automation with fast deployment and ease of use, rather than enterprise-grade complexity.

Does Yooz cover the full procure-to-pay cycle?

Yes. It handles purchase requisitions and orders through invoice capture, approval, payment, and reconciliation.

How many systems does Yooz integrate with?

Yooz integrates with more than 250 financial and accounting systems, including Sage, Microsoft Dynamics, NetSuite, QuickBooks, and Acumatica.

Can Yooz pay vendors directly?

Yes. Its Yooz Rising product line includes a direct payment feature alongside reconciliation.
